The Mets have "contemplated the idea of" signing free agent Mark Reynolds to play an outfield position, according to Ken Davidoff of the New York Post.
It seems like a bad idea. Reynolds has logged only two career major-league innings in the outfield, and that was back in 2007 with the Diamondbacks. He's drawn enough interest since being non-tended by the Orioles that he met be out of the Mets' price range anyway.
